ZIP 67739 and ZIP 67748 are ZIP Code areas in Kansas.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 67748 has the higher population (2,695 vs 224 in ZIP 67739). ZIP 67748 has the higher median household income ($74,231 vs $61,250 in ZIP 67739). ZIP 67748 has the higher median home value ($152,300 vs $48,500 in ZIP 67739).
